Biography:
Professor Kang’s main research areas are groundwater hydrology and environmental impacts of subsurface-based energy development. Application areas include groundwater impacts and greenhouse gas emissions related to oil and gas development and geologic storage of carbon dioxide. Her current projects involve (1) the development of analytical, numerical, and combined analytical-numerical multi-scale models of multi-phase flow through porous media, (2) field measurements of gas fluxes, and (3) geospatial and statistical data analysis. Fluids of interest include carbon dioxide, methane and other hydrocarbons, and water.
